Cash Advance Fee: Your bank will charge you a 3% to 5% cash advance fee on each transaction. The minimum fee ranges from $5 to $10, depending on the amount you’re taking as an advance. Definition of an investment interest expense. When you borrow money to buy property for investment purposes, any interest you pay on that borrowed money becomes an "investment interest expense." You would not be able to buy shares online if you do not have a PAN . As per government mandate, every individual needs to furnish his/her PAN to execute financial transactions in India. SYF will purchase the current credit portfolio …Is It a Good Idea to Buy Stocks With a Credit Card? Using a credit card to buy stock generally isn't a good idea. Investing in stock requires taking on the risk of losing money. By buying stock with a credit card, you could wind up with a high-interest credit card balance and lose your investment.10 Agu 2018 ... Most forms of investments do not allow credit card transactions. However, some do. For instance, you can invest in the National Pension Scheme (NPS) using your credit card. Similarly, you can buy gold and pay for the same through a credit card. However, investments in stocks and mutual funds do not allow …
